Transfer Ratios at a Glance

The relationship between DBS Points and Krisflyer miles operates on a standardised conversion framework. Cardholders should familiarise themselves with the specific rates applicable to their credit card variants, as different DBS cards offer varying transfer efficiencies.

Standard Conversion

Most DBS credit cards convert at a ratio of 2.5 DBS Points to 1 Krisflyer mile. This baseline rate applies across the majority of DBS card products in the market.

Premium Tier Cards

Selected DBS premium cards offer enhanced conversion rates, with some variants delivering up to 2 DBS Points per 1 Krisflyer mile. These cards typically carry higher annual fees but compensate through improved transfer efficiency.

Minimum Transfer Block

Transfers must meet a minimum threshold, typically requiring at least 5,000 Krisflyer miles per transaction. This minimum ensures the transfer process remains administratively viable for both parties.

Key Considerations Before Transferring

Before initiating any points conversion, cardholders should evaluate several factors that influence the overall value derived from the transfer process. The timing of transfers, associated fees, and available promotions all play significant roles in maximising returns.

One critical aspect involves understanding that DBS Points expire after 12 months from the card anniversary date if they remain unused. This expiration policy makes regular transfers preferable to stockpiling points indefinitely. Cardholders tracking their points balance through the DBS website or mobile application can monitor expiration dates and plan conversions accordingly.

Transfer Fees and Charges

DBS applies a small administrative fee for each conversion request. While the exact fee varies by card type, it generally amounts to a small percentage of the transferred value. Some premium cardholders enjoy fee waivers, making them more attractive for regular converters.

Step-by-Step Transfer Process

The conversion procedure itself is straightforward and can be completed entirely through digital channels. Cardholders with linked DBS and KrisFlyer accounts find the process particularly streamlined, requiring only a few confirmations to complete.

Account Requirements

Prior to transferring, ensure both your DBS credit card account and KrisFlyer membership are active and in good standing. The KrisFlyer membership must be registered under the same name as the DBS cardholder to prevent processing delays. Additional verification may be required for first-time transfers between the accounts.

Understanding Processing Timeframes

Once a transfer request is submitted, the miles typically appear in your KrisFlyer account within three to five business days. During peak periods or promotional campaigns, processing times may extend slightly. Cardholders should account for these timeframes when planning award bookings to avoid disappointment.

The transfer confirmation serves as documentation should any discrepancies arise. Keeping records of these confirmations until the miles reflect accurately in your KrisFlyer profile proves prudent practice for all converters.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the minimum number of DBS Points required for conversion?

Conversions are processed in blocks, typically requiring at least 5,000 Krisflyer miles per transfer, which translates to varying DBS Points requirements depending on your card’s conversion ratio.

Can I transfer DBS Points from multiple cards to the same KrisFlyer account?

Yes, provided all cards are held under the same name and the transfers are initiated from each respective card account. Each transfer will follow that specific card’s conversion rate.

Are there any promotions that improve the conversion rate?

DBS and Singapore Airlines periodically run joint promotions that offer bonus miles or reduced transfer fees. These are typically communicated through official channels and have specific validity periods.

What happens if my DBS Points expire before I transfer them?

Expired DBS Points cannot be recovered or transferred. Setting up regular transfers or monitoring expiration dates through the DBS app helps prevent unintentional point loss.
